Energy efficiency

Double glazing has been proven scientifically to be an effective method to minimize heat loss and gain in homes. It can reduce the flow of heat during winter and prevent unwanted sun gain in summer. This will reduce your energy usage. This leads to lower energy costs and a lower carbon footprint. A well-insulated house can keep warm longer and use less heating. This will reduce your energy costs over time.

The air between the two glass panes in a double glazed window is a great insulation that slows the process of transferring heat from and into a home. Air molecules are not able to conduct heat as efficiently as glass. This is why double glazed windows are more energy efficient than single-glazed windows.

Condensation control

Condensation can cause the surfaces like walls and floors to smell musty, spread mildew spores and negatively affect woodwork. Double glazing reduces condensation by keeping the interior surface of the glass warm. If windows are not correctly installed, moisture may get in between the panes, causing damage window seal. If the window repair near me is attached to an brick wall, water may develop between the glass panes and frame. In these cases it is necessary to replace the entire window is needed.

Condensation in the panes of windows with double glazing is usually caused by a leaky seal. This could be due to the aging sealant which allows air to pass through the gap between the panes and reacts with the moisture present in the air. Rubber strips are typically used as sealants in windows with double glazing that are cheaper than of silicone, which could speed up condensation.

A professional double-glazing installer will ensure that the sealant around the edges of the frames is correctly applied and that the gaps are sealed to stop cold air from getting into your home. They should also provide an extensive service following the installation to ensure you are happy with their work.

Double glazed windows can lead to condensation on the outside. This is an indication of a window that is thermally efficient and performing well. This kind of condensation usually occurs late at night or early in the morning, when temperatures are low and there is little wind. Installing extractor fans in kitchens and bathrooms and also using a dehumidifier inside the house can help reduce the amount of condensation.
